How many directional terms are there?

Since cardinal means 'primary', or 'serving as an essential component', they would be north, south, east and west.Cardinal directions refer to the four point of a compass north, south, east, and west. The actual word Cardinal is from the Latin word cardinalis which mean "principal, chief, essential," the root of cardinalis is from cardo (generally cardinis) meaning "that on which something turns or depends; pole of the sky,".
